How can I get my lips to stop licking?

Keep lip balm nearby and use it whenever you feel like licking your dry, cracked lips. Moreover, consuming more water can be quite beneficial. Lip skin is more delicate than other skin types, therefore it dries out much more quickly if you don't drink enough water. A hydrated body means hydrated skin.

What was utilized prior to lip balm?

Ancient societies used pure beeswax, honey, and natural oils to nourish their lips before Chapstick was created. But over the years, we've also employed some other bizarre materials, including earwax, petroleum jelly, and glycerin!

What exactly is a blind zit?

Blind zits are zits that develop beneath your skin. They might remain below the surface of your skin, resulting in discomfort and irritation. Alternatively they could break the skin's surface as a whitehead, blackhead, or red lump. Warm compresses and lotions that battle acne are part of the treatment.

Exactly why do lips swell?

Underlying inflammation or a buildup of fluid under the surface of your lips might result in swollen lips. Swollen lips can be brought on by a variety of illnesses, from minor skin issues to serious allergic reactions. my lips turn white when I stretch them?

Fordyce splotches The dots frequently develop in clusters or patches and are very small, slightly elevated, and range in size from one to three millimeters. These can be white or yellowish, and stretching out your skin might make them easier to view. Often, fordyce patches have no symptoms.
